Now AT&T has reconfirmed plans to launch new DVR add-ons. During a talk at the 2019 Global TMT West Conference in Las Vegas, AT&T Chief Financial Officer John Stephens confirmed that AT&T plans to use the new DVR add-on to generate more revenue from DIRECTV NOW.

We still do not know when the new DVR add-on will launch, but we have some leaks that hint at how the new add-ons will work. According to reports, DIRECTV NOW plans to keep their 20 hours as a baseline for all subscribers. From there you can add 30 hours to get 50 hours of storage or 100 hours to get 120 hours of storage. The add-ons will start at $5. Some have reported the 100 hours of extra storage will cost $10 a month, but as of today that has not been verified.
